December 2020 Post Views: 79 ORYX Gaming is set to enter Germany’s iGaming market following a content deal with StarGames – the online casino site of Greentube Malta Ltd. ORYX Gaming announced the agreement in a press release on Wednesday, ushering the arrival of their games in the strong European market. ORYX brings with top online casino game in Germany The Slovenia-headquartered company will be supplying the online casino arm of Greentube with premium content. ORYX has formed an exclusive remote gaming server (RGS) partners with studios such as Arcadem, Kalamba Games, Gamomat, Givme Games, and Golden Hero. All of the games developed by these studios will now be available on StarGames tentatively in 2021. Moreover, the deal also enables a wide selection of third-party content and marketing tools such as extra spins, tournaments, and leaderboards, and data services available through Oryx Hub aggregator. Preparation for Market Entry StarGames’ experience in Germany’s iGaming market convinced ORYX to collaborate with the content aggregator. Greentube Malta’s online casino is doing business in Germany by virtue of its licensed operations in Schleswig-Holstein – a state in the northernmost part of the country. StarGames is preparing to acquire a nationwide gaming license as Germany braces to become a regulated iGaming market next year. The company has already created a landing page that regularly provides updates on the said topic. Matevz Mazij, Managing Director for Oryx Gaming, said “This deal is a significant step for us as we gear up to take on the German online market once it fully opens next year. StarGames has a long experience and a leading position in Germany, which will be an advantage to us as we establish and grow our business in the country.” StarGames is doing its due diligence to assure its content offering is in accordance to the most recent Responsible Gaming regulations and guidelines, which are aimed to minimize gambling-related harm and to promote social responsibility. ORYX Gaming has recently agreed to a similar deal with fast-rising live game supplier Quik Gaming. This deal allows games like SuperBlocs, Lotto Roulette and Wheel of Fire Live available on ORYX hub.
